Compare all specifications:
2011 Fiat Bravo | 2010 Mazda 3 | |
Make | Fiat | Mazda |
Model | Bravo | 3 |
Year Released | 2011 | 2010 |
Body Type | Hatchback | Hatchback |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1956 cc | 2184 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 163 HP | 148 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 3500 RPM |
Torque | 361 Nm | 360 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1750 RPM | 1800 RPM |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Diesel |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| 5-speed man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4340 mm | 4590 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1800 mm | 1755 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1500 mm | 1471 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2610 mm | 2639 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 57 L | 55 L |
